FT Vest Gold Strategy Quarterly Buffer ETF (BATS:BGLD – Get Free Report) saw a significant growth in short interest in May. As of May 29th, there was short interest totaling 22,599 shares, a growth of 71.6% from the May 14th total of 13,168 shares. Approximately 0.7% of the shares of the stock are sold short.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 23,414 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 1.0 days.
FT Vest Gold Strategy Quarterly Buffer ETF Stock Performance
Shares of BATS:BGLD opened at $16.67 on Monday. The company has a fifty day moving average of $17.22 and a 200-day moving average of $18.74. FT Vest Gold Strategy Quarterly Buffer ETF has a 52-week low of $16.34 and a 52-week high of $25.34.

FT Vest Gold Strategy Quarterly Buffer ETF Company Profile
The FT Cboe Vest Gold Tactical Buffer ETF (BGLD)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the SPDR Gold Trust index. The fund aims for specific buffered losses and capped gains on SPDR Gold Trust ETF over a specific holdings period. The fund invests in US treasury bills, cash-like instruments and FLEX options through a wholly-owned subsidiary. BGLD was launched on Jan 20, 2021 and is managed by First Trust.
